Output 0118f1c5358262820d71e4c0b5eec8b5b23c5245b1478e76f1618a3c16f16dd4:0

value
363154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c280bed81688ab0fcc6667f5c59a40844fc9bef OP_EQUAL
address
3EU6VtLxezxfrfZSoG6ZycYeHuhDEqiP3p
transaction
0118f1c5358262820d71e4c0b5eec8b5b23c5245b1478e76f1618a3c16f16dd4
confirmations
145869
spent
true